socket.io(node.js)とまったく同じように機能するライブラリを探していますが、他のプラットフォーム、c ++、またはpythonで必要です。
これはウェブサイトのサーバーアプリケーションについてです。私のアプリはnode.jsで動作しますが、C ++/pythonなどに変更する必要があります。
socket.ioは、サーバーに接続するためのテクノロジーを自動的に選択するため、優れています。使用するブラウザー/ハードウェアによって異なります。
何か案は?
Pythonの場合、>>PythonでWebSocketを調べることができます<< DjangoでSocket.IOを使用できますか? Djangoは、Python言語を使用するWebフレームワークです。
TornadIO2を介したPython用のSocket.IO実装があります。これは、 Tornado非同期Webサーバーで使用されます。TornadIO1.0のときにこれを使用しました
Goには私が使用しているものがありますが、Socket.IO 0.6.xとのみ互換性があります:go-socket.io
そして、他のリンクについては、socket.io Wikiを見てください:
https ://github.com/learnboost/socket.io/wiki
socket.ioのプロトコル定義は、 https: //github.com/LearnBoost/socket.io-specから入手できます。
私はいくつかのプロジェクトに参加しており、さまざまな理由で実際に独自のクライアントを実装することにしました。輸送をサポートするだけでよいので、特に難しいことではありません(xhr-pollingが最も簡単なimhoです)。
また、コミュニティに還元する可能性もあります。